How can the practice of empathy and active listening contribute to conflict resolution and improved teamwork within a group dynamic, both in personal and professional settings?

Conflict Resolution
Empathy allows individuals to understand and relate to the emotions and perspectives of others, fostering a sense of connection and trust within a group. Active listening involves fully engaging with others, showing respect and validating their feelings, which can help de-escalate conflicts and promote open communication. By practicing empathy and active listening, individuals can better understand each other's needs and concerns, leading to more effective problem-solving, collaboration, and cohesion within a team dynamic in both personal and professional settings.
